Frequently Asked Questions & Stockists.
Where are your products manufactured?
We like to manufacture in Australia where possible. However, some items are not, our enamel accessories are made by our friends in China. Our tea towels are made by our friends in India. All screen printing and packaging is produced in South Australia.
Stubby holders, stationary, postcards, stickers, and magnets are all made in Australia.
Where are you based?
We are based in Adelaide, South Australia.
What are your popular souvenirs?
Our magnets, keyrings, lapel pins, stubby holders and tea towels are extremely popular. As are our Outback flora candles.
What are you candles made from?
Our candles are 100% vegan soy candles. these are hand poured in Adelaide and are great for travelling with.
